Skoda Enyaq RS Race Concept: Eco-Friendly and Race-Ready

Skoda Enyaq RS Race

Skoda Motorsport has introduced the innovative Enyaq RS Race concept, a race car that redefines the approach to eco-friendly design. Instead of using traditional carbon fibre, the Enyaq RS Race relies on biocomposite materials made from flax fibre. This eco-conscious approach drastically reduces the vehicle’s weight by 316 kg compared to the standard Enyaq Coupe RS. The concept also serves as a testbed for future electric vehicles (EVs) using sustainable materials and technology.

Key Highlights

  • Eco-Friendly Lightweight Materials: The Enyaq RS Race concept replaces carbon fibre with flax fibre-based biocomposite materials. This not only reduces weight but also maintains the rigidity typically provided by carbon fibre. The body panels, including the front fenders, bumper, roof side panel, rear wing, and diffuser, all feature this sustainable material.
  • Wider and Lower Stance: The race car features a 72 mm wider front track and a 116 mm wider rear track, along with a ride height reduced by 70 mm. These modifications enhance the car’s performance on the track.
  • Enhanced Aerodynamics: The Enyaq RS Race concept comes equipped with a more aggressive aero kit, including larger air inlets, a pronounced front splitter, a larger rear diffuser, and a massive rear wing. Roof vents channel fresh air into the cabin, while winglets guide airflow over the spoiler for optimal downforce.

Interior and Mechanical Modifications

Inside, Skoda has stripped the car down to the essentials. The Enyaq RS Race concept features racing bucket seats, a regulation roll cage, and polycarbonate windows. Interestingly, the 13-inch infotainment touchscreen remains, offering a touch of comfort in an otherwise race-focused cockpit.

Skoda Enyaq RS Race

Mechanically, Skoda swapped the standard suspension with sports shock absorbers and added carbon ceramic brakes. The concept also includes a hydraulic handbrake, a fire extinguishing system, and a quick-release steering wheel. Additionally, skid plates protect the underbody components from potential damage during aggressive driving.

Powertrain and Performance

Though Skoda has not altered the powertrain, the Enyaq RS Race concept retains the 335 bhp and 545 Nm of torque from the standard Coupe RS. The top speed remains at 180 km/h, but the weight reduction has significantly improved the car’s acceleration. The concept can now sprint from 0 to 100 km/h in 4.6 seconds, nearly a full second faster than the road-going version.

Future Implications

Skoda has not disclosed any plans to put the Enyaq RS Race concept into production or enter it in competitions. However, the use of sustainable and lightweight materials could shape the development of future Skoda vehicles, offering a glimpse of what’s to come in the EV space.

The Skoda Enyaq RS Race concept is a bold step toward sustainable racing technology, combining cutting-edge materials with eco-friendly innovation. As the automotive world shifts towards electric vehicles, Skoda’s approach to integrating biocomposites could pave the way for more environmentally conscious race cars in the future.
